Louvre Window Repair in Alpharetta, GA
Louvre window repair services focus on restoring the functionality and appearance of these distinctive windows, which are often used to add architectural charm and allow natural light into homes. Projects typically include fixing broken or damaged sash components, replacing worn-out hardware, addressing issues with window operation, and restoring the seal to improve energy efficiency. Property owners interested in this service should understand the specific type of louvre window installed, the extent of any damage or wear, and whether the goal is to restore functionality, improve insulation, or enhance aesthetic appeal.
Before requesting louvre window repair, homeowners often want to know about the scope of work involved, including whether parts are available for older or custom window styles, and if the repair process will preserve the original design. It’s also useful to consider the condition of the window frame and surrounding structure, as repairs may sometimes involve addressing underlying issues that could affect the window’s stability or performance. Clear communication about the desired outcomes and the current state of the windows can help ensure that repairs meet expectations.

Common Louvre Window Repair Jobs
Louvre Window Repair Services - Expert repairs help restore the functionality and appearance of louvre windows.
Glass Replacement - Damaged or broken glass panels can be replaced to improve safety and insulation.
Hinge & Pivot Repairs - Faulty hinges and pivots are fixed to ensure smooth opening and closing.
Seal & Weatherproofing - Seals are restored or replaced to prevent drafts and enhance energy efficiency.
Frame Restoration - Wooden or metal frames are repaired or reinforced to extend window lifespan.
Maintenance & Tune-Ups - Regular service keeps louvre windows operating properly and prevents future issues.
Louvre Window Repair Questions
What types of issues can occur with Louvre windows? Common problems include broken glass, damaged frames, and difficulty opening or closing the window.
Are repairs possible for aged or damaged Louvre windows? Yes, repairs can address broken slats, faulty hinges, and frame deterioration to restore functionality.
What are typical signs that a Louvre window needs repair? Difficult operation, visible damage, drafts, or broken glass are indicators that repairs may be needed.
Can damaged Louvre windows be replaced instead of repaired? Replacement options are available when damage is extensive or repairs are not feasible for the specific window.
